package com.tzld.piaoquan.api.controller; import com.tzld.piaoquan.api.model.vo.WeComPushMessageParam; import com.tzld.piaoquan.api.model.vo.WeComPushMessageVo; import com.tzld.piaoquan.api.service.WeComService; import com.tzld.piaoquan.common.common.base.CommonResponse; import lombok.extern.slf4j.Slf4j; import org.springframework.beans.factory.annotation.Autowired; import org.springframework.web.bind.annotation.PostMapping; import org.springframework.web.bind.annotation.RequestBody; import org.springframework.web.bind.annotation.RequestMapping; import org.springframework.web.bind.annotation.RestController; import java.util.List; @Slf4j @RestController @RequestMapping("/wecom") public class WeComController { @Autowired private WeComService weComService; @PostMapping("/pushMessage/get") public CommonResponse> getPushMessage(@RequestBody WeComPushMessageParam param) { log.info("param={}", param); return weComService.getPushMessage(param); } }